Output 035400516fada53d6548c73217889b2c706099399bd14e8407fb778e34067030:1

value
766376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a2b61ff77f02e788bc53e1924f31b1a17603671 OP_EQUALVERIFY OP_CHECKSIG
address
19DmnZBTA3Ursv6w6QNRy67TRTPgLYsxSJ
transaction
035400516fada53d6548c73217889b2c706099399bd14e8407fb778e34067030
spent
true